Concert Chorale is a select, advanced choir of 70-80 singers, primarily composed of undergraduate students. This ensemble presents 4-5 concerts throughout the year and often combines with the CSUS instrumental ensembles to perform major works. Concert Chorale performs a variety of repertoire, from Sacred to Secular, from Renaissance to 20th Century, from folk songs to opera choruses. All vocal performance majors and music education majors (choral emphasis) must enroll in Concert Chorale as their primary performing ensemble. Tours and off-campus performances are frequently part of the ensembles calendar.
